Did you know that every type of drug you put in your body has to pass through your kidneys? While some drugs are easily processed and expelled through the kidneys, others may harm them. Here are six types of drugs that damage your kidneys.

Pain Relief Drugs

While over-the-counter pain relief drugs are usually safe to consume, taking large amounts of ibuprofen, naproxen, or the likes can actually damage your kidneys. Thousands of Americans have damaged their kidneys unknowingly by taking these drugs for prolonged periods.

Drugs Containing TDF

Tenofovir Disoproxil Fumarate (TDF) is widely used in the HIV preventative medicine Atripla. The medicine has been widely linked with serious kidney injuries including declining kidney function, acute kidney injury, chronic kidney disease, acute renal failure, kidney failure, and more.

Atripla is so notorious for causing kidney problems that in 2018, a class action Atripla lawsuit took place. Before taking such medicines, make sure you discuss the risks with your doctor and opt for alternatives if available.

Antibiotics

Antibiotics can also be quite dangerous for your kidneys if you do not take them properly. People who already have kidney disease should take a very little amount of antibiotics as opposed to people with normal functioning kidneys. Do not take antibiotics without a doctor’s consultation. Illegal Drugs Like Ecstasy

All illegal drugs, whether they are cocaine, ecstasy, or heroin cause high blood pressure, heart failure, stroke, and in many cases, sudden death. Cocaine, amphetamines, heroin are particularly bad for the kidneys as they can cause significant damage to the organs over time.

Laxatives

Over-the-counter laxatives are safe to consume for most people. However, some forms of laxatives are prescribed by the doctor to clean a bowel. These laxatives can be harmful to the kidneys. Make sure to consult with your physician and let them know if you have had any history with kidney problems.
